Explained: Who are the Hattis of Himachal Pradesh, and why do they want ST status?
What is the News? The Union Home Minister has assured the Chief Minister of Himachal Pradesh that the Centre would consider the request for inclusion of the Hatti community in the list of Scheduled Tribes. What is the Hatti Community? In a first, IndiGo uses Indian navigation system to land aircraft
What is the News? An IndiGo-operated ATR 72-600 aircraft landed at Kishangarh airport using an approach process guided by GAGAN or GPS-aided GEO Augmented Navigation. With this trial, India has joined a small group comprising the US, Japan and Europe with its own satellite-based augmentation system(SBAS). What is GAGAN?
